UBS lowered its 2027 oil price outlook for West Texas Intermediate (WTI) crude to an average of $75 per barrel from $80 per barrel. — A lower long-term commodity price target reduces the projected future cash flows and valuation for major oil producers like ExxonMobil.
-0.60UBS reduced its Q2 2026 earnings per share estimate for ExxonMobil to $3.14, which is significantly below the Wall Street consensus of $3.43. — A downward revision that trails consensus typically leads to negative price action upon the official earnings release.
-0.40ExxonMobil's business segments are showing strong quarter-over-quarter growth, with projected Q2 upstream earnings rising to $8.63 billion from $5.7 billion in Q1. — Strong operational momentum and improving margins in refining and chemicals offset some of the bearishness from the revised EPS estimate.
